I recently started using Ubuntu (8.10), and I decided to map a few keyboard shortcuts to the same keys as in Windows, since those are what I'm used to. In particular, there are several shortcuts using the Windows key that I use frequently (Win-L to lock the screen, Win-E to open a file browser, etc.)

I changed these all with no problem...except for one thing. I also mapped "Hide all windows and focus desktop" to Win-D, but when I tested it, my system froze for about a minute (the mouse would move, but I couldn't do anything else), and then X Windows restarted and I had to log back in. I thought there was a conflict with another shortcut or something, so I tried Win-F instead. Nope...same thing. Basically like hitting Alt-Ctrl-Backspace, but with a minute's pause first. But, if I change the shortcut back to Alt-Ctrl-D (the default), it works fine.

I can live with using a different shortcut if I have to, but I'd really like this to just work. Is this a known bug? Is there anything I can change to fix it, perhaps?
